基于聚合酶链反应的伴放线放线杆菌d血清型分离株基因分型

Genotyping of Actinobacillus actinomycetemcomitans serotype d isolates based on polymerase chain reaction.

作者信息

Doğan B, Saarela M, Asikainen S

机构信息

Institute of Dentistry, University of Helsinki, Finland.

出版信息

Oral Microbiol Immunol. 1999 Dec;14(6):387-90. doi: 10.1034/j.1399-302x.1999.140611.x.

DOI:10.1034/j.1399-302x.1999.140611.x
PMID:10895697
Abstract

The aims of the study were to determine the genetic diversity of the rare Actinobacillus actinomycetemcomitans serotype d and to compare the ability of the repetitive extragenic palindromic element (REP)-based polymerase chain reaction (PCR) with that of the arbitrarily primed (AP)-PCR to discriminate between and within A. actinomycetemcomitans serotypes. The material included 26 A. actinomycetemcomitans serotype d isolates, 3 reference strains, and 21 A. actinomycetemcomitans isolates, representing the previously described 17 AP-PCR genotypes from 4 serotypes (a, b, c and e). Among A. actinomycetemcomitans serotype d isolates (n = 26), the AP-PCR primer distinguished 2 genotypes, whereas the REP-primer pair (REP1R-I and REP2-I) and the (GACA)4 primer each produced one genotype. Among the total of 50 A. actinomycetemcomitans isolates, REP-primer pair distinguished 6 genotypes, the primer (GACA)4 7 genotypes, and the AP-PCR 19 genotypes. Among A. actinomycetemcomitans serotype a isolates (n = 6), REP-primer pair yielded 3 genotypes and (GACA)4 and AP-PCR primer 4 genotypes, and among serotype e isolates (n = 6) 3 genotypes. All serotype b isolates (n = 7), representing the AP-PCR genotypes 2, 9, 8, 12, 13, 16 and serotype c isolates (n = 5), AP-PCR genotypes 3, 4, 14, 15, belonged to the (REP1R-I and REP2-I)-PCR genotype 4 and to the (GACA)4-PCR genotype 4. In conclusion, based on both the AP-PCR method and the less discriminative REP-PCR methods, the present genotyping results indicated limited genetic diversity among serotype d isolates of A. actinomycetemcomitans.

摘要

本研究的目的是确定罕见的伴放线放线杆菌血清型d的遗传多样性,并比较基于重复外显子回文元件(REP)的聚合酶链反应(PCR)与任意引物(AP)-PCR区分伴放线放线杆菌血清型之间及血清型内部的能力。材料包括26株伴放线放线杆菌血清型d分离株、3株参考菌株以及21株伴放线放线杆菌分离株,后者代表先前描述的来自4种血清型(a、b、c和e)的17种AP-PCR基因型。在伴放线放线杆菌血清型d分离株(n = 26)中,AP-PCR引物区分出2种基因型,而REP引物对(REP1R-I和REP2-I)以及(GACA)4引物各自产生1种基因型。在总共50株伴放线放线杆菌分离株中,REP引物对区分出6种基因型,(GACA)4引物区分出7种基因型,AP-PCR区分出19种基因型。在伴放线放线杆菌血清型a分离株(n = 6)中,REP引物对产生3种基因型,(GACA)4和AP-PCR引物产生4种基因型;在血清型e分离株(n = 6)中产生3种基因型。所有血清型b分离株(n = 7),代表AP-PCR基因型2、9、8、12、13、16,以及血清型c分离株(n = 5),AP-PCR基因型3、4、14、15,均属于(REP1R-I和REP2-I)-PCR基因型4和(GACA)4-PCR基因型4。总之,基于AP-PCR方法以及区分能力较弱的REP-PCR方法,目前的基因分型结果表明伴放线放线杆菌血清型d分离株的遗传多样性有限。
